Description: |
This book is one of four which together are considerably updated and totally revised texts that arose out of the very successful "DNA Cloning, Volume I-IV" books in the Practical Approach series. This particular book describes all the necessary background and detailed laboratory methods for the core techniques used in every molecular biology laboratory. |
Synopsis: |
This volume provides detailed laboratory protocols, advice, hints and tips, example data, key literature citations, background information, and troubleshooting comments for the steps used in most molecular biology laboratories. It covers transformation, construction of cDNA and genomic libraries, probe preparation, analysis of gene organisation and expression, in vitro mutagenesis, and DNA sequencing. The information provided is a completely up to date account of each topic by established researchers. These two volumes, the first of four, are a thoroughly revised and up dated version of the original ones published in the Practial Approach series. Together they will offer a complete guide to the major techniques required by modern molecular biology laboratories. |
